Understanding the Turbonetics Anti-lag Module
The Turbonetics Anti-lag Module is designed to maintain boost pressure during gear shifts and deceleration, effectively reducing turbo lag. This technology allows for quicker throttle response and improved acceleration, making it a valuable addition for high-performance vehicles.

Performance Metrics of the BMW M3
The BMW M3 in question is a powerhouse, originally producing 700 horsepower. With the installation of the Turbonetics Anti-lag Module, the vehicle experienced a remarkable increase in performance, adding an additional 40 horsepower. This boost not only enhances the car’s speed but also improves its overall drivability.

Acceleration Comparison
With the Anti-lag Module, the BMW M3 was able to achieve faster 0-60 mph times, showcasing the effectiveness of the technology in reducing lag and improving acceleration. The following metrics were recorded:
- Without Anti-lag: 3.5 seconds
- With Anti-lag: 3.2 seconds
